I have used Exo and Kifaru of the ones you mentioned. The new ARK frame is great just couldn’t find a bag I liked and ended up running the ARK frame with an EXO K3 bag. I also have 2 EXO K4 packs that I really like and are top notch.
 
I used a K4 this season to pack out 4 elk and a pronghorn. It’s the most comfortable pack I have used under weight. I like it better than the stone glacier I was running before.
 
I have both. I generally prefer the EXO under 60 lb and the ARK over 60 lb. I also prefer the sheet frame on the ARK for carrying quarters and heads. Both are really good though.
